[libvirt] [PATCH 04/11] build: drop the mktempd gnulib module

Daniel P. Berrangé berrange at redhat.com
Thu Oct 3 13:53:11 UTC 2019


The mktempd module in gnulib provides an equivalent to 'mktemp -d' on
platforms which lack this shell command. All platforms on which libvirt
runs the affected tests have 'mktemp -d' support, so the gnulib module
is not required.
